Yep! Brand new it should be 0001

In reply to klo Jul 28, 2004

But if it's 0001 it doesn't mean it's brand new.

Anyway, if the cf card used with the camera wasn't fresh formatted, and contained a picture labeled img_1702.jpg, the camera, even a new one, would automatically increment the file counter to img_1703.jpg.
